On October 28, 2014, Jeremy Martin, a 29-year-old deputy with the Santa Fe County Sheriff's Office, was fatally shot at the Hotel Encanto in Las Cruces, New Mexico. The incident occurred during a work trip when Martin and his partner, Tai Chan, had checked into the hotel after dropping off a prisoner at an Arizona prison. Following their arrival, the two deputies visited several restaurants, where they consumed alcohol, leading to a heated argument.
